Meanwhile, here’s how to recognize each technique so you can check quickly:
- Anecdote: a short story about a specific person or event (names/specifics, narrative tense). Look for a teenager described doing things during a school day.
- Definition: explicit defining language (“is defined as,” “means,” “refers to,” “is”) or a sentence that states what “educational technology” is.
- Description: lists or explains characteristics or benefits, uses sensory or explanatory detail rather than steps or a story.
- Sequence of steps: chronological or instructional markers (“first,” “then,” “next,” “step,” “after that”) showing how to access or do something.
